            Baseball Recap: Exeter Township Eagles vs. Wilson Bulldogs        
        
		
        
        
            Exeter Township has relied on a stalwart pitchers averaging four  runs allowed per game, but that average took a hit  on Wednesday. They fell  11-6 to the Wilson Bulldogs. The Eagles have struggled against the Bulldogs recently, as the game was their fourth consecutive lost meeting.
  Brenton Feathers made the most of his time at bat despite the final result and  scored two  runs and  stole a base while going 3-for-3.  Jake Franek also deserves some recognition as  he  got his first  hit of the season.
Having lost for the first time  this season, Exeter Township  fell to 3-1. As for Wilson, the  victory (which was their third in a row) raised their record to 3-0.
 Both  teams will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Exeter Township will head out to  square off against J.P. McCaskey  at 4:15  p.m.  on Friday. Exeter Township is facing J.P. McCaskey at the right time seeing as J.P. McCaskey is stuck on  a  four-game losing streak. As for Wilson, they will head out on the road to  challenge  North Penn  at 4:15  p.m.  on Thursday. North Penn's pitching crew has only allowed 3.5  runs per game  this season, so Wilson's hitters will have their work cut out for them.
